Tax litigation is the formal process of resolving tax disputes in court when negotiations with the IRS or state agencies fail. It can involve issues like assessments, penalties, collections, or even criminal tax matters, and skilled attorneys guide clients through each step to protect their financial interests.

Knowing when to involve a tax litigation attorney can make the difference between a manageable dispute and a financial crisis. If you’ve received an IRS summons, notice of deficiency, or intent to levy, these are clear signals that your case is moving beyond routine tax issues and into legal territory. Other red flags include the IRS pursuing aggressive collection actions, a criminal tax investigation, or unresolved disputes from audits that could escalate in court. At this stage, having experienced attorneys on your side ensures that your rights are protected, defenses are raised quickly, and the IRS cannot overreach.

If you’re involved in a tax dispute and litigation is imminent, there are multiple strategies to address the situation and minimize potential consequences. Here are some effective steps to consider:
Settlement Negotiations
A skilled tax litigation lawyer can negotiate directly with the IRS to reduce what you owe or arrange manageable repayment terms. This proactive approach often prevents prolonged court battles while safeguarding your financial stability.
Offer in Compromise (OIC)
An OIC allows eligible taxpayers to settle for less than the full balance if paying in full would cause hardship. Our attorneys assess your finances carefully and guide you through the application to secure the best possible outcome.
Penalty Abatement
If you’ve been hit with penalties, a tax lawyer may be able to reduce or remove them for reasonable causes like illness or financial hardship. We present compelling evidence to the IRS, significantly easing your tax burden.
Tax Court Litigation
When other solutions fail, Tax Court litigation may be necessary to challenge IRS decisions or negotiate better terms. Our experienced attorneys represent you with precision, leveraging tax law to protect your interests.
Federal District Court or Court of Federal Claims
Some complex disputes move into Federal District Court or the Court of Federal Claims for broader proceedings. Our team is prepared to handle these high-level cases with thorough representation and strategic planning.
Criminal Tax Defense
If you face accusations of tax fraud or other violations, criminal tax defense is critical to protect your rights. We explore every legal avenue to minimize penalties and shield you from the most severe consequences.
Innocent Spouse Relief
Innocent spouse relief protects you from being held liable for your partner’s tax issues. Our legal team proves your eligibility so you aren’t unfairly burdened by someone else’s mistakes.

The appeals process in tax litigation allows individuals to challenge decisions made by tax authorities. If you disagree with the tax decision, your attorney can file an appeal, presenting compelling evidence to a higher court or appellate court or tax tribunal to seek a more favorable outcome. This process often involves revisiting complex tax issues and applying refined knowledge of tax law.
Tax litigation cases are typically handled in Tax Court, Federal District Court, or state courts, depending on the nature of the dispute. The choice of court depends on whether the case involves federal or state tax issues, with Tax Courts being specifically designed for tax-related matters. The United States Department of Justice may also be involved in certain high-profile cases, requiring specialized knowledge of federal legal frameworks.
